Exhibition Wall Layout Design

Exhibition wall layout design refers to the planning and arrangement of display spaces and materials in an exhibition setting. It involves considerations of aesthetics, functionality, and spatial organization to create an effective display that engages visitors and communicates the intended message. Key elements include the selection of appropriate displays, lighting, and signage, as well as ensuring a logical flow of traffic through the exhibition space.

theme culture wall design

Theme culture wall design refers to the artistic and creative process of designing walls that showcase cultural elements. This can include the integration of traditional motifs, symbols, and artistic expressions specific to a particular culture. The design aims to convey the essence of a culture, often in public spaces or educational institutions. Elements such as typography, colors, and imagery are carefully chosen to represent the cultural heritage and values. The process involves research, conceptualization, and execution, including the selection of appropriate materials and techniques.

Design of theme walls

Theme wall design refers to the artistic arrangement and decoration of a specific wall in an interior space. It involves selecting appropriate colors, patterns, textures, and materials to create a cohesive and visually appealing space. This design can enhance the ambiance of a room, reflect the room's purpose, or integrate specific design themes. Factors such as the room's function, lighting, and the inhabitants' preferences are considered in the design process.
